Wind power solutions work best when the following conditions are met:
- You have a house or farmhouse spread over a big area. Typically, wind power solutions are employed in areas that spread over an acre.
- The average wind speed in your area is around 11 miles per hour. If you stay in a place that has little wind flow, your system will not work at optimal efficiency. Consult an expert before installing the wind power solution at home.
- You need to draw water from external sources. You can install a wind power system even when you do not need to draw water from outside. However, if you need to draw water from outside on a regular basis, a wind power system offers the best solution.
- Your house needs a lot of uninterrupted power supply. Combating those power outages is easy with the pollution-free wind power systems. You need no longer worry about a break in your work because of a power uncertainty.
A typical wind power system is composed of a tower and five blades to churn out wind energy. The length of the wind tower varies depending on the location of your house.
You may need a longer tower if you are in low-wind zone; you can work with a shorter tower if you live by the beach. Using a wind generator, this wind energy can be converted into useful electrical energy to be employed at home for running various electrical appliances. You can even store the power generated for later use, making wind generators more efficient than convention power systems.
